Once part of a prehistoric sea, you’ll find fossils of sea animals from around the state. Then, as Kansas’ geography included a dense forest, you’ll find remnants of the Silvisaurus, Kansas’ dinosaur, since the fossils were found near the town of Wells. The Silvisaurus was about 13 feet long and had bony spines on its shoulders and tail.

Jan 6, 2020 · Another interesting geological structure in Missouri is the Thirty Eighth Parallel Lineament, which is a region 10 to 20 miles wide that runs from Vernon Country Kansas to Ste. Genevieve Missouri near the 38th Parallel. This area contains many features symbolic of geological stress such as folds, faults, and broken and mixed fragments of bedrock. Coordinates: 38°N 98°W Kansas ( / ˈkænzəs / ⓘ) is a state in the Midwestern United States. [10] Its capital is Topeka, and its most populous city is Wichita. Kansas is a landlocked state bordered by Nebraska to the north; Missouri to the east; Oklahoma to the south; and Colorado to the west.Geography and Geospatial Sciences.
